If-Koubou

Čuvajte svoju SSH sesiju Linuxa od odspajanja

Čuvajte svoju SSH sesiju Linuxa od odspajanja (Kako da)

Ja sam vrsta geekova koji je SSH klijent otvoren u svako doba, povezan s mojim najčešće korištenim poslužiteljima, tako da imam brz pristup za praćenje i bilo što drugo. Kao takav, to me jako iritira kad se povežem pa imam nekoliko metoda za održavanje vaše sesije.

Ssh klijent možete konfigurirati za automatsko slanje koda bez koda kod svakog broja sekundi tako da vas poslužitelj neće odspojiti. To se postavljanje ponekad naziva Keep-Alive ili Stop-Disconnecting-So-Much u drugim klijentima.

Globalna konfiguracija

Dodajte sljedeći redak u datoteku / etc / ssh / ssh_config:

ServerAliveInterval 60

Broj je iznos od sekunde prije poslužitelja s poslati no-op kod.

Trenutna konfiguracija korisnika

Dodajte sljedeće retke u ~ / .ssh / config datoteku (stvorite ako ne postoji)

Domaćin *
ServerAliveInterval 60

Pazite da s drugom retku ubaciš prostor.

Konfiguracija po hostu

Ako samo želite omogućiti zadržavanje žive za pojedinačnim poslužiteljem, možete je dodati u ~ / .ssh / config datoteku sa sljedećom sintaksom:

Host * hostname.com
ServerAliveInterval 60

Djeluje sasvim dobro, nadam se da pomaže drugom ondje.